diff --git a/tests/System/integration/api/com_users/Users.cy.js b/tests/System/integration/api/com_users/Users.cy.js index 7415756d2bfa7..17d088c4c88ee 100644 --- a/tests/System/integration/api/com_users/Users.cy.js +++ b/tests/System/integration/api/com_users/Users.cy.js @@ -81,7 +81,7 @@ describe('Test that users API endpoint', () => { cy.get('#username').type('test'); cy.get('#password').type('test'); cy.get('#remember').check(); - cy.get('.controls > .btn').click(); + cy.get('.controls > button[type="submit"].btn').click(); cy.visit('/index.php?option=com_users&view=login'); cy.get('.com-users-logout').should('contain.text', 'Log out'); }); diff --git a/tests/System/integration/site/components/com_users/Login.cy.js b/tests/System/integration/site/components/com_users/Login.cy.js index e97036d560627..5db74825376ea 100644 --- a/tests/System/integration/site/components/com_users/Login.cy.js +++ b/tests/System/integration/site/components/com_users/Login.cy.js @@ -6,7 +6,7 @@ describe('Test in frontend that the users login view', () => { cy.get('#username').type('test'); cy.get('#password').type('test'); cy.get('#remember').check(); - cy.get('.controls > .btn').click(); + cy.get('.controls > button[type="submit"].btn').click(); cy.visit('/index.php?option=com_users&view=login'); cy.get('.com-users-logout').should('contain.text', 'Log out'); @@ -22,7 +22,7 @@ describe('Test in frontend that the users login view', () => { cy.get('#username').type('test'); cy.get('#password').type('test'); cy.get('#remember').check(); - cy.get('.controls > .btn').click(); + cy.get('.controls > button[type="submit"].btn').click(); cy.get('a:contains(Automated test login)').click(); cy.get('.com-users-logout').should('contain.text', 'Log out'); diff --git a/tests/System/integration/site/modules/mod_login/Default.cy.js b/tests/System/integration/site/modules/mod_login/Default.cy.js index 0cc08d9a4623f..a83fca45c9ed1 100644 --- a/tests/System/integration/site/modules/mod_login/Default.cy.js +++ b/tests/System/integration/site/modules/mod_login/Default.cy.js @@ -15,7 +15,7 @@ describe('Test in frontend that the login module', () => { cy.get('#modlgn-username-16').type('test'); cy.get('#modlgn-passwd-16').type('test'); cy.get('input[name="remember"]').check(); - cy.get('.mod-login__submit > .btn').click(); + cy.get('button[name="Submit"]').click(); cy.get('.mod-login-logout').should('contain.text', 'Hi automated test user'); });